Aaron Ramsey Planning More Improvement After Signing New Arsenal Deal

Aaron Ramsey has now been at Arsenal for a year, after opting for the Gunners over Manchester United and Everton when he left Cardiff City, and the 18-year-old is delighted that the last 12 months have gone so well, after he inked a new long-term deal at the Emirates Stadium yesterday.

"I am very pleased I chose Arsenal last year," Ramsey told the club's official website.

"I always knew that Arsenal was the club for me, they had the best plan for me. They have a history of bringing through youngsters, giving them opportunities and turning them into world-class players.

"I'm very pleased to sign a new deal. I think I've had a decent first season, I've learnt a lot and now I'm looking forward to next season. I am committed to this club, I am an Arsenal player and I want to be an Arsenal player.

"Obviously I have grown up a bit in the past year because I live on my own now, so I have to look after myself. I am a bit more independent now. But I wouldn't say I have changed too much."

Like team-mate Theo Walcott, Ramsey was a full international before becoming an Arsenal regular, having featured several times for John Toshack's Welsh team, and the midfielder sees many similarities between himself and the Englishman.

"We both came from Championship clubs to join Arsenal and I think my first year has been quite similar to Theo's first year at Arsenal," he added.

"But then in the second year he played a lot more games and got more experience under his belt, so hopefully I can take the same path.

"We've talked about it before, I've asked him how he found it when he was in my position. Now I want to be more regular in the starting eleven, get a lot more games under my belt and hopefully start more games as well. They are my targets."
